What is a match in CS 2?
A match in CS 2 is a series of rounds between two teams: terrorists and counter-terrorists. Each team has specific objectives based on the game mode, like Hostage Rescue or Bombing. Matches can be public online games or part of professional tournaments with large prizes.
How long does a CS 2 match last?
The duration of a CS 2 match depends on factors like game mode, number of rounds, and player skill. Matches typically last 30 to 60 minutes. Hostage Defense/Rescue games are usually shorter than Bombing mode games. Professional matches can last longer due to strategic approaches and tactic discussions.
What are the conditions for winning in CS 2?
In CS 2, victory depends on the game mode. In Hostage Defense/Rescue, the counter-terrorists win by freeing the hostages or killing all the terrorists. In Bomb Detonation, the counter-terrorists win by destroying the bomb or killing all the terrorists, and the terrorists win by detonating the bomb or killing all the counter-terrorists.
